
The cost of electricity in Utah varies depending on several factors, including the type of utility provider, the amount of electricity consumed, and the specific location within the state. As of the latest data available up to June 2024, the average residential electricity price in Utah is around 10.5 cents per kilowatt-hour (kWh). This is slightly lower than the national average in the United States. However, it's important to note that electricity rates can fluctuate due to changes in fuel prices, regulatory policies, and other market conditions. To get the most accurate and up-to-date information on electricity costs in Utah, it's recommended to check with local utility providers or the Utah Public Service Commission.

Average Monthly Bills: Typical electricity expenses for Utah households and businesses
Utah's average monthly electricity bill for households stands at approximately $95, according to recent data from the U.S. Energy Information Administration. This figure can fluctuate based on several factors, including the size of the home, the number of occupants, and the efficiency of the appliances and lighting used. For businesses, the average monthly bill is significantly higher, averaging around $700. This disparity is due to the larger scale of operations and the greater demand for electricity in commercial settings.
Several factors contribute to the overall cost of electricity in Utah. The state's electricity rates are relatively low compared to the national average, but the cost can still add up due to high consumption levels. Utah's climate, with its hot summers and cold winters, leads to increased energy usage for heating and cooling. Additionally, the state's growing population and expanding economy have led to an increase in energy demand, which can drive up costs.
To manage these expenses, both households and businesses can take steps to reduce their energy consumption. This can include upgrading to energy-efficient appliances, improving insulation, and installing programmable thermostats. Businesses may also benefit from energy audits to identify areas where they can cut back on usage. Furthermore, Utah offers various incentives and programs to encourage energy efficiency, such as rebates for energy-efficient upgrades and time-of-use pricing plans that can help consumers save money by shifting their energy usage to off-peak hours.
In conclusion, while Utah's electricity costs are relatively low, the average monthly bills for households and businesses can still be significant. By understanding the factors that contribute to these costs and taking steps to reduce energy consumption, residents and business owners can better manage their electricity expenses and contribute to a more sustainable energy future for the state.

Rate Plans: Different pricing structures offered by Utah utility companies
Utah utility companies offer a variety of rate plans to cater to different consumer needs and preferences. These plans can significantly impact how much electricity costs for residents and businesses. One common type of rate plan is the fixed rate plan, where the cost per kilowatt-hour (kWh) remains constant throughout the billing period. This provides predictability and stability in electricity costs, which can be beneficial for budgeting purposes.
Another option is the tiered rate plan, which charges different rates based on the amount of electricity consumed. Typically, the more electricity used, the higher the rate per kWh. This encourages energy conservation and can result in lower costs for consumers who use less electricity. Some utilities also offer time-of-use (TOU) rate plans, where rates vary depending on the time of day electricity is used. Peak hours, usually in the late afternoon and early evening, have higher rates, while off-peak hours have lower rates. This plan can be advantageous for consumers who can shift their energy usage to off-peak times.
Additionally, there are renewable energy rate plans available, which provide electricity generated from sources like solar, wind, or hydroelectric power. These plans often come with a premium due to the higher cost of generating renewable energy, but they offer an environmentally friendly option for consumers who prioritize sustainability.
It's important for Utah residents and businesses to carefully evaluate these rate plans and choose the one that best fits their energy consumption patterns and priorities. By understanding the different pricing structures offered by utility companies, consumers can make informed decisions that can help them manage their electricity costs more effectively.

Renewable Energy Options: Availability and costs of solar, wind, and other renewable sources
Utah's renewable energy landscape is rapidly evolving, offering residents and businesses a variety of options to reduce their carbon footprint and potentially lower their electricity costs. Solar energy, in particular, has become increasingly accessible and affordable in recent years. The state's abundant sunshine makes it an ideal location for solar panel installations, which can significantly offset traditional electricity usage. According to recent data, the average cost of a residential solar panel system in Utah is around $2.60 per watt, with commercial systems costing slightly less. This translates to a total installation cost of approximately $13,000 to $20,000 for a typical home system, depending on the size and efficiency of the panels.
Wind energy, while less prevalent than solar in Utah, is also a viable option for those looking to invest in renewable sources. The state's mountainous regions and open plains provide ample wind resources, particularly in areas like the Wasatch Front and the Uintah Basin. However, wind turbine installations are generally more expensive and complex than solar panels, requiring larger upfront investments and more extensive permitting processes. As a result, wind energy is more commonly utilized by larger entities, such as municipalities or corporations, rather than individual homeowners.
In addition to solar and wind, Utah also offers opportunities for geothermal energy, particularly in the western part of the state. Geothermal systems harness the earth's natural heat to generate electricity or provide heating and cooling for buildings. While the initial costs of geothermal installations can be high, they often result in significant long-term savings due to their efficiency and low maintenance requirements.
For those interested in exploring renewable energy options, it's essential to consider the specific costs and benefits associated with each source. Factors such as installation costs, maintenance requirements, energy production capabilities, and available incentives or rebates should all be taken into account. Additionally, it's important to consult with local experts and contractors who can provide guidance on the most suitable renewable energy solutions for a particular property or location.
Overall, Utah's renewable energy options present a compelling opportunity for residents and businesses to reduce their reliance on traditional electricity sources, lower their energy costs, and contribute to a more sustainable future. By carefully evaluating the available options and consulting with local experts, individuals can make informed decisions about how to best incorporate renewable energy into their lives and operations.

Energy Efficiency Programs: Initiatives and incentives to reduce electricity consumption
Utah has implemented various energy efficiency programs aimed at reducing electricity consumption and promoting sustainable practices. These initiatives are designed to benefit both residential and commercial consumers by offering incentives and resources to help them manage their energy usage more effectively.
One notable program is the Utah Energy Efficiency Program (UEEP), which provides financial incentives for energy-efficient upgrades in homes and businesses. This program offers rebates for the installation of energy-efficient appliances, lighting, and HVAC systems, as well as for home energy audits and weatherization services. By participating in the UEEP, consumers can significantly reduce their energy costs while also contributing to a more sustainable future.
Another key initiative is the Rocky Mountain Power (RMP) Energy Efficiency Program, which offers a variety of incentives and resources for both residential and commercial customers. RMP provides rebates for energy-efficient appliances, lighting, and HVAC systems, as well as for home energy audits and weatherization services. Additionally, RMP offers a demand response program that rewards customers for reducing their energy usage during peak demand periods.
Utah has also implemented several policy measures to promote energy efficiency, such as the Utah Energy Efficiency Act, which requires utilities to offer energy efficiency programs and incentives to their customers. This legislation has helped to drive the development of innovative energy efficiency initiatives across the state.
In conclusion, Utah has made significant strides in promoting energy efficiency through a combination of programs, incentives, and policy measures. These initiatives not only help to reduce electricity consumption but also provide economic benefits to consumers and contribute to a more sustainable future for the state.

Comparison with Neighboring States: How Utah's electricity costs stack up against nearby states
Utah's electricity costs are often a topic of interest for residents and businesses alike. When compared to neighboring states, Utah's electricity rates are relatively competitive. According to data from the U.S. Energy Information Administration, Utah's average residential electricity price is lower than that of Colorado, Arizona, and Nevada, but slightly higher than Wyoming and Idaho.
One factor contributing to Utah's competitive electricity costs is the state's diverse energy mix. Utah generates electricity from a variety of sources, including coal, natural gas, nuclear, and renewable energy. This diversification helps to mitigate the impact of fluctuations in fuel prices and ensures a more stable electricity supply.
Another factor influencing Utah's electricity costs is the state's regulatory environment. The Utah Public Service Commission closely monitors and regulates the state's utilities, ensuring that they operate efficiently and pass on cost savings to consumers. This regulatory oversight helps to keep electricity rates in check and prevents utilities from charging excessive prices.
In addition to these factors, Utah's electricity costs are also influenced by the state's geography and climate. Utah's mountainous terrain and cold winters require more energy for heating, which can drive up electricity demand and prices. However, the state's abundant natural resources, such as coal and natural gas, help to offset these costs.
Overall, Utah's electricity costs are relatively competitive when compared to neighboring states. The state's diverse energy mix, regulatory environment, and geographic factors all contribute to its electricity prices. While Utah's electricity costs may not be the lowest in the country, they are still reasonable and provide a good value for the state's residents and businesses.
